Abstract

A statistical analysis of accidents on road transport in the Russian Federation involving trucks was carried out. We have studied the legal acts regulating road safety in General and the implementation of cargo transport in particular. The object of the study is the state of road safety. The possibility of using regression for modeling and analyzing the relationship between the number of cargo vehicles and the length of roads is considered. These indicators are taken into account for 85 regions of the Russian Federation. The result of the joint influence of independent variables on the number of road accidents is obtained. A multiple regression equation is given to explain the model parameters. The constructed model is useful, and the selected two variables “length of highways, km”, “number of cargo vehicles, units” allow predicting the level of accidents on road transport.

Introduction

In the Russian Federation, about 80% of the total volume of cargo transported by all modes of transport (rail, air, sea) is carried out by road. Most of the goods cannot be transported to the consumer without the participation of road transport. The growth of production volumes, changes in the specifics of products, the need and development of the economy reflect the demand for road freight transport. The main industries that use road freight transport are related to retail. Road freight transport is economically feasible for use in short-and medium-distance transportation [27]. About 7% of accidents occur due to violations of traffic rules by truck drivers. The severity of accidents involving trucks is the highest of all the committed accidents and is 10.1 deaths per 100 accidents. Reducing accident rates is a priority task of the state
